Appearance
Instalação da Aplicação Cliente
A aplicação cliente corre no browser, tendo sido desenvolvida em Vue, com recurso à framework quasar (https://quasar.dev/).
Pré-requisitos
Para que a aplicação funcione, necessita que o computador tenha instalado:
- o node (versão 18)
- yarn
- quasar cli (para instalar, correr "yarn global add @quasar/cli")
Instalação em modo de desenvolvimento
Para iniciar a aplicação em modo de desenvolvimento, deverá:
- Fazer uma cópia do repositório de código (https://beforeafterpt.visualstudio.com/BPF)
- Abrir a linha de comandos (cmd.exe)
- Ir para a pasta do repositório
- Na primeira vez, utilizar o comando "yarn", para instalar todas as bibliotecas npm necessárias
- Nessa pasta correr o comando "quasar dev"
Instalação em modo de produção
Atualização da versão
Antes de correr a compilação em modo produção, deverá abrir a página index.template.html, que se encontra na root da pasta src, e alterar a data que se encontra no span com o id "metaVersion"
- Abrir a linha de comandos (cmd.exe)
- Ir para a pasta do repositório
- Nessa pasta correr o comando "quasar build -m=spa"
- Copiar o conteúdo da pasta "\dist\spa" para a pasta do servidor "\wwwwroot"